IT

자동화된 상담 신청서 생성 시스템 구축하기

esmile1 2024. 12. 20. 16:56

자동화된 상담 신청서 생성 시스템 구축하기

안녕하세요! 오늘은 구글 설문지와 구글 시트를 활용하여 상담 신청서를 자동으로 생성하는 방법에 대해 알아보겠습니다. 이 과정은 교육, 기업, 개인 프로젝트 등 다양한 분야에서 활용될 수 있으며, 업무의 효율성을 크게 향상시킬 수 있습니다.

***주요 내용 요약

  • 구글 설문지를 통해 상담 신청서를 작성하고,
  • 구글 시트에 자동으로 저장하며,
  • 앱스 스크립트를 사용해 데이터를 처리하는 시스템을 구축합니다.

이 시스템은 다음과 같은 이점을 제공합니다:

  • 수작업으로 작성하던 문서를 자동화하여 시간과 노력을 절약할 수 있습니다.
  • 데이터의 정확성을 높이고, 실시간으로 정보를 관리할 수 있습니다.
  • 사용자 친화적인 인터페이스로 쉽게 접근할 수 있습니다.

***사용 방법 단계별 설명

아래는 이 시스템을 구축하기 위한 20단계의 세부 과정입니다:

  1. 구글 계정 생성: 구글 설문지와 시트를 사용하기 위해 구글 계정을 만듭니다.
  2. 구글 설문지 만들기: 구글 드라이브에 접속하여 새로운 설문지를 생성합니다.
  3. 설문지 제목 및 설명 입력: 상담 신청서의 제목과 간단한 설명을 입력합니다.
  4. 필수 항목 추가: 신청자의 이름, 연락처, 이메일 등 필수 정보를 입력받기 위한 질문을 추가합니다.
  5. 응답 형식 설정: 각 질문의 응답 형식을 설정합니다 (예: 단답형, 선택형 등).
  6. 설문지 디자인 수정: 필요에 따라 설문지의 디자인을 수정하여 사용자 친화적으로 만듭니다.
  7. 응답 수집 설정: 응답이 제출될 때 알림을 받도록 설정합니다.
  8. 구글 시트 연결: 설문지의 응답을 자동으로 저장할 구글 시트를 생성하고 연결합니다.
  9. 앱스 스크립트 열기: 구글 시트에서 "확장 프로그램" > "Apps Script"를 선택하여 스크립트 편집기를 엽니다.
  10. 스크립트 코드 작성: 상담 신청서 데이터를 처리할 앱스 스크립트 코드를 작성합니다.
  11. function onFormSubmit(e) { var sheet = SpreadsheetApp.getActiveSpreadsheet().getActiveSheet(); var row = e.values; sheet.appendRow(row); }
  12. 스크립트 실행 권한 부여: 스크립트를 처음 실행할 때 권한을 요청하므로 이를 승인합니다.
  13. 테스트 응답 제출: 설문지를 통해 테스트 응답을 제출하여 데이터가 제대로 저장되는지 확인합니다.
  14. 응답 데이터 확인: 구글 시트에서 응답이 제대로 기록되었는지 확인합니다.
  15. PDF 문서 생성 코드 추가: 필요한 경우, 응답 데이터를 기반으로 PDF 문서를 자동으로 생성하는 코드를 추가합니다.
  16. 이메일 발송 코드 추가: PDF 파일을 이메일로 전송하는 기능을 추가합니다.
  17. function sendEmail() { var emailAddress = "example@example.com"; // 수신자 이메일 var subject = "상담 신청서"; var body = "첨부된 파일을 확인해 주세요."; MailApp.sendEmail(emailAddress, subject, body, { attachments: [DriveApp.getFileById("파일ID")] }); }
  18. 전체 코드 테스트: 모든 기능이 제대로 작동하는지 전체 코드를 테스트합니다.
  19. 사용자 피드백 수집: 실제 사용자로부터 피드백을 받아 시스템 개선점을 찾습니다.
  20. 시스템 개선 및 업데이트: 피드백을 바탕으로 시스템을 개선하고 업데이트합니다.
  21. 최종 문서화: 시스템 사용 방법과 절차를 문서화하여 다른 사용자와 공유합니다.
  22. 정기적인 유지보수 계획 수립: 시스템의 지속적인 운영과 관리를 위해 정기적인 유지보수 계획을 세웁니다.

이 과정을 통해 여러분은 상담 신청서를 효율적으로 관리할 수 있는 자동화 시스템을 구축할 수 있습니다. 구글의 다양한 도구를 활용하여 업무의 효율성을 높이고 시간을 절약해 보세요!